Flood Watch
Issued: 2:26 PM Jul. 13, 2025 – National Weather Service
...FLOOD WATCH REMAINS IN EFFECT THROUGH LATE TONIGHT... * WHAT...Flash fl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ible.Localized rainfall amounts of 2-3 inches tonight in a few hours. * WHERE...A portion of central New York, including the following areas, Madison, Northern Oneida, Onondaga, Schuyler, Seneca, Southern Cayuga, Southern Oneida, Steuben, Tompkins and Yates. * WHEN...Through late tonight. * I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ations. Flooding may occur in poor drainage and urban areas.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- Showers and thunderstorms developing across the area can be slow-moving and lead to heavy rainfall and instances of flash flooding. Rainfall rates can near, or exceed 1 inch per hour at times. Multiple rounds of thunderstorms training over the same area can also result in localized flooding. - https://www.weather.gov/safety/flood P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... You should monitor later forecasts and be prepared to take action should Flash Flood Warnings be issued. &&
